About Barangay Maanyag

Classified as a small barangay, Barangay Maanyag is one of the administrative divisions of Tomas Oppus in Southern Leyte, Eastern Visayas, Philippines.

According to the 2020 Philippine census, Barangay Maanyag had a population of 578. This made it the 13th largest of 29 barangays in Tomas Oppus by population, placing it in the middle tier of the municipality. Residents of Barangay Maanyag accounted for approximately 3.40% of the total population of Tomas Oppus, which stood at 16,990 in the same census year.

Between the 2015 and 2020 censuses, the population of Barangay Maanyag changed from 469 to 578, a shift of +23.2% over the five-year period. This places the barangay among those with growing populations in Tomas Oppus. Barangay Maanyag is officially classified as rural, a designation applied to barangays with lower population density and predominantly non-built-up land use.

Tomas Oppus is a municipality comprising 29 barangays, and serves as the governing unit directly responsible for local services in Barangay Maanyag, including public health, sanitation, peace and order, and civil registration. Within the wider province of Southern Leyte, which contains 500 barangays across its component cities and municipalities, Barangay Maanyag ranks 298th by 2020 population. Southern Leyte is classified as a 3rd by the Bureau of Local Government Finance, a category that reflects the province's annual regular income.

Barangay Maanyag is governed by an elected Sangguniang Barangay composed of a Punong Barangay and seven kagawads, with the Sangguniang Kabataan representing the youth. The next BSKE, set for Monday, November 2, 2026, will elect officials to four-year terms as provided under Republic Act No. 12232.
